WebOct 18, 2024 · Sleep deprivation for just six days can increase cortisol levels, which in turn can elevate blood sugar. Sleep deprivation can also trigger an increase in growth hormone, which decreases glucose uptake by the muscles, further contributing to a rise in blood glucose levels.
